There is a famous saying: “Give me a child until the age of 7 and I’ll show you the man.” Now, there is a scientific research to support this famous saying.
They watched small birds in new environments, and wrote down how much they explored(探索). Birds that grew up with very outgoing birds were more outgoing themselves. Scientists at the universities of Exeter, UK and Hamburg, Germany did studies on birds. They found that their personalities(个性) were affected most by the birds around them when they grew up – more so than genes.
Nick Royle from the University of Exeter in the UK said the research was surprising because it shows that “for these birds, personality is mainly determined(决定) by environment.” However, human personalities are a lot more complicated than birds, so there is much we still don’t know. The nature vs nurture debate will continue for a long time, if not forever.

Many disposable things are made of plastic. People throw them away after only using them once. It is a waste of natural resources and is very bad for the environment. Do you know, one Chinese person makes as much as 400kg of waste a year! Most of that waste comes from disposable things. In Beijing, people throw away about 19,000 tons of plastic bags and 1,320 tons of plastic lunch bowls every year! Plastic can take between 100 and 400 years to break down. So the less plastic we throw out, the better the environment will be. So, wherever you travel, bring your own things and use them again and again.
Back at home and school, you can also do something to make our world a better place. Try to do these things in your daily life: Use cloth shopping bags, not plastic ones. After using a plastic bag, wash it out and let it dry. Then you can use it over and over again. Do not use paper cups. At your school canteen(食堂), use your own bowl and chopsticks instead of disposable ones.

According to the study, teenagers who eat breakfast weigh around 5 pounds less than teenagers who do not. Although they take in more calories (卡路里) in the morning, they are more active during the day because they have more energy. This means they burn more calories than non-breakfast eaters. The breakfast does not even have to be very healthy, as eating anything is better than nothing.
The study also showed that eating breakfast keeps teenagers feeling full for longer, so they will not eat too many snacks (零食) later in the day. This is good news as most popular snacks, like sweets and potato chips, are usually unhealthy and full of calories.
Another big advantage of eating breakfast is that it helps teenagers do better at school.This is because it gives them more energy to keep their attention in class.
What"s more, a study in the UK showed that adults (成年人) who eat breakfast daily put on less weight and also perform better at work.
Whatever your age is, take time to have breakfast every day.
